Nike blasted for 'playful update' to St. George's Cross featuring pink and blue on England's new football kit

On Monday, Nike unveiled the English football squad's new home and away kits, and while there were a number of marked differences between them and the ones used in previous years, perhaps the most striking change was that made to St. George's Cross on the back of the collar. The legendary flag had been made unrecognizable, its timeless red and white intersecting bars dyed varying shades of pink, red, and blue.

The move, which Nike called a "playful update," was roundly criticized by everyone from average football fans to Prime Minister Rishi Sunak.



Announcing the design via X, Nike said the colors were meant to "unite and inspire." What the sportswear giant didn't anticipate is that people would "unite" around a common hatred of the redesign.

In light of the backlash, Culture Secretary Lucy Frazer said Nike had made a mistake.

"Fans should always come first, and it's clear that this is not what fans want," she declared. "Our national heritage - including St George's Cross - brings us together. Toying with it is pointless and unnecessary."

As the BBC reports, when asked about the design, Sunak said he, like many others, "prefers the original," echoing Frazer's sentiments that the flag is a "source of pride."

"When it comes to our national flags, we shouldn't mess with them," he told reporters. "They're perfect as they are."

Even Labour leader Keir Starmer called on Nike to "change it back."
